Book Description:
Canada s smallest province has a rich and fascinating history. Named Abegweit (cradled in the waves) by the Mi kmaq the 'Garden of the Gulf' has evolved over the centuries into a world vacation destination. The revised and updated Land of the Red Soil includes new information about the Confederation Bridge, Japanese tourism, the changing economy, the writings of L M Montgomery and much more.
